The Wangwang Paradise, which has been repeatedly delayed, is finally coming. It is reported that the Wangwang Special Experience Hall is expected to officially open to the public in October, and 2,000 opening tickets were sold in limited quantities during the 6.1 period.
However, compared to the delays, this Wangwang Special Experience Hall is significantly smaller than the amusement park sketches previously circulated online. This time, we bring you close-up photos; the project has basically entered the final stage.
Main project topped out
Red Wangzai plane has arrived


The main building, consisting of several large cans, is basically complete, and the interior should still be under intense renovation.

The roads outside are still dirt, and workers are transporting materials.
A large open space behind the building is still all yellow earth, with a few scattered green plants. According to the renderings, there will be many small children's amusement facilities here in the future for children to play.
Wangwang Special Experience Hall rendering
In addition, the considered a treasure by the chairman of Wangwang, has accompanied him and the company's growth red Gulfstream small plane with the Wangzai logo was slowly lifted by a giant crane, and the "Wang" on the wings was particularly eye-catching in the wind. 。

A circular ramp extending from the nose of the plane allows visitors to view the plane 360 degrees, and combined with the corporate values of "fate, confidence, and unity," the treasure conveys happiness and beauty of the two sides being one family.


According to previous revelations from the Wangzai Club Weibo, the Wangwang theme park will combine classic and trendy amusement facilities, integrating AI, 5D and other technological experiences, and combining natural scenery. Unlimited snacks, food, drinks, entertainment, and photo opportunities are all available in one stop.
Even an aerial view of the entire Wangwang Paradise was revealed. The entire Wangwang Paradise is the head of Wangzai, and the Wangwang Special Hall currently under construction is only a small part of the entire park.
